The Wilde Adler , also called Erlitz in the upper reaches , ( Czech Divoká Orlice, Polish Dzika Orlica ) rises in the Topielsko and Czarne Bagno upland moors on the western slope of the Biesiec (Dead Man) in the Góry Bystrzyckie ( Habelschwerdter Mountains ) in Poland . The source is located at a height of 800 meters above sea level . From the confluence with the Černý potok (Schwarzbach) it forms the Polish-Czech state border over a length of 26 kilometers and separates the Orlické hory ( Eagle Mountains ) from the Góry Bystrzyckie . The border area ends at the Zemská brána protected area . Below Klášterec nad Orlicí and Lhotka is the Pastviny water reservoir with an equalization basin at Nekoř . The river flows further past Líšnice , Žamberk (Senftenberg), Helvíkovice (Helkowitz) and Kostelec nad Orlicí (Adlerkosteletz). The section between Litice nad Orlicí and Potštejn forms a valley with numerous rapids called Litický oblouk . Below Doudleby and Kostelec nad Orlicí the river calms down. At the narrowest point it has an average flow velocity of 11.5 m³ / s. Larger inflows from right Rokytenka , Zdobnice , Bělá , Olešnický Potok and Bahnice left hand Brodec .
At Albrechtice nad Orlicí (Albrechtsdorf) the wild eagle unites with the silent eagle to form the eagle . Its total length is 99.3 kilometers.
